Guide on How to Fix Cellular Option Missing on Windows
A cellular network is very important for people who depend on cellular networks for internet connectivity. The problem of cellular option missing on Windows will make you unable to access the Internet. Don’t worry. This guide on MiniTool will teach you to fix this annoying issue.
Cellular Option Missing on Windows
There is a cellular feature that allows you to connect to the cellular network automatically. However, sometimes, you may find the cellular option disappeared from your Settings. If you encounter this problem, you cannot access the Internet. Cellular option missing on Windows can be caused due to many reasons such as a non-working adapter driver, incorrect Windows settings, and so on.
Before adopting some more advanced methods, you need to know how to enable the cellular feature. By the way, the cellular option will not be shown if it has been disabled in the settings app. Follow the steps below to enable it.
- Open your Settings app and click on Network & Internet.
- In the right pane, find Cellular and toggle the button to On.
If the cellular option still does not show, keep reading to obtain more useful methods.
Fix 1: Run the Network Troubleshooter
This Network Troubleshooter tool can be beneficial for repairing some network issues. You can use it to check if something went wrong with your network connection first. Here are the steps to run it.
Step 1: Right-click on the Start button and choose Settings to open it.
Step 2: In Settings, click on System > Troubleshoot > Other troubleshooters.
Step 3: Find Internet Connections and click on the Run button.
Step 4: In the new window, choose Troubleshoot my connection to the Internet.
Wait for the detecting process to be completed. If it detects any problems, it will automatically fix them or offer some suggestions on how to solve them.
Fix 2: Reset Network Settings
Wrong or damaged network settings can cause the cellular option to disappear. In this case, you can try resetting the network, which will restore all previous settings to default. This practice can solve most problems including cellular option not showing Windows 10. Work with the following steps.
Step 1: Press the Win I keys to open the Settings app.
Step 2: In Settings, switch to the Network & Internet section and click on Advanced Network Settings.
Step 3: Scroll down the list to find Network Reset and click on it.
Step 4: Click on the Reset now button to get started.
Fix 3: Reconfigure Cellular Network Adapter
One of the causes of this problem is incorrect cellular network adapter configuration. You are supposed to reconfigure it to check if the cellular option can appear. Here are the steps.
Step 1: Right-click on the Start button and select Run to open the Run dialog.
Step 2: Type ncpa.cpl in the box and press Enter.
Step 3: In the Network Connections page, right-click on the Ethernet and choose Properties.
Step 4: In the Ethernet Properties window, click on Configure….
Step 5: Switch to the Advanced tab. Under Property, locate and select Selective Suspend.
Step 6: Click on the box under Value and choose Enabled. Click on OK to save changes.
